There's a whole host of things that have given me that issue - bad cd drive, scratched disk, etc. More importantly, I've seen sysinstall never actually format the disk, so then it can't write to it. The way I fixed it is by hitting "w" (write) before "q" (quit) in both the fdisk and partition pages of sysinstall. I've seen this behavior on both 6.2 and 7.0, and I've never paid enough attention to repeat it or figure out what I did wrong - I just use the write command manually and things seem happier. Make sure you see a box pop up on the partition/label page when you hit write that mentions something about "doing newfs ....", otherwise just start over. I think that's the magic step.
